Souvarine, on the other hand, is an anarchist. He has no hope that conditions will improve, and he is determined to wait for his opportunity to destroy for the sake of destruction. Souvarine cannot be said to be a revolutionary, because he does not believe that the violence he will do will bring about a better society. His proposed violent actions are actions without hope. He sees the system as thoroughly evil and worthy of nothing but such destruction.
